Anritsu S332B Site Master, Cable and Antenna Analyzer, 25 MHz to 3300 MHz Specifications
Hand-Held Tester for Transmission Lines and other RF Components
The Site Master is a hand held SWR/RL (standing wave ratio/return loss), and Distance-To-Fault (DTF) measurement instrument that includes a built-in synthesized signal source. All models include a keypad to enter data and a liquid crystal display (LCD) to provide graphic indications of SWR or RL over the selected frequency range and selected distance. The Site Master is capable of up to 2.5 hours of continuous operation from a fully charged field-replaceable battery and can be operated from a 12.5 dc source. Built-in energy conservation features can be used to extend battery life over an eight-hour work day. The Site Master is designed for measuring SWR, return loss, or cable insertion loss and locating faulty RF components in antenna systems. Power monitoring is available as an option. Site Master models S114B and S332B include spectrum analysis capability. The displayed trace can be scaled or enhanced with frequency markers or a limit line. A menu option provides for an audible “beep” when the limit value is exceeded. To permit use in low-light environments, the LCD can be back lit using a front panel key.

Anritsu S114C Site Master, Cable and Antenna Analyzer, 2 MHz to 1600 MHz
|
Site Master is the instrument of choice for transmission line (coax and waveguide) and antenna installation and maintenance. It is the best way to reduce maintenance expenses and improve quality. It replaces stacks of heavy, expensive, and complex test equipment. Site Master’s frequency domain reflectometry technique allows it to locate faults and degradations before they become catastrophic failures, thereby creating huge cost and time savings.
The Site Master is a precision hand-held return loss/SWR and fault location measurement instrument. OSL calibration can be applied to all 1-port measurements (RL/VSWR/cable Loss/DTF) enabling accurate vector corrected measurements. The Site Master series offers wide frequency coverage, from 2 MHz to 20 GHz. Built-in fault location, RF power monitor, bias tee, and spectrum analysis capabilities are available. Site Masters' SPA has dedicated routines for one-button measurements of field strength, channel power, occupied bandwidth, adjacent channel power ratio (ACPR), Carrier-to-Interference, and interference analysis. Light weight, rugged design, and wide temperature range make them ideal for field applications. Site Master’s proprietary design provides superior immunity to on-channel RF interference, which is important for live site testing.
Handheld Software Tools is a Windows® compatible software program provided with every Site Master unit. This software program provides many useful features, including a database for Site Master measurements, Smith Chart display of S11, zoom capability, a “drag-n-drop” overlay for measurement comparison, the capability to download data to a PC, and the capability to upload data such as custom cable list or traces to selected Site Master models. Advanced printing capabilities are provided by Handheld Software Tools including user definable plot scaling and a multiple plots per page option.
Site Master is the first test tool to provide the required accuracy, interference immunity, and repeatability for transmission line/antenna commissioning, and maintenance of today’s wireless systems infrastructures.
Standard Features • Accurate return loss/SWR and fault location measurements • Accurately tests RF transmission lines and antennas • Superior immunity to on-channel interference for testing at co-located antenna sites • Multilingual user interface: English, German, Spanish, French, Chinese, Japanese • TFT color display (S810D and S820D) • Accurate 2-port vector measurements to measure gain, antennato-antenna isolation (S251C) • Spectrum analysis (S114C and S332D) • 130, 259, or 517 data points • Standard color TFT Display (S331D and S332D) • Synthesizer accurate to 75 ppm • Internal memory saves up to 200 traces • Instrument configuration up to 25 configurations • Alphanumeric trace naming • Time, Date stamp • Field replaceable battery • Segmented limit lines • Six markers • Graticule lines • Trace overlay • Direct printing via RS232 serial port • Remote operation via RS232 serial port
Optional Features • Option 5: Power Monitor to measure power – external detector needed (S113C, S114C, S251C, S331D, S332D, S810D and S820D) • Option 10A: Built-in +12 to+24 V variable bias tee (S332D) • Option 10B: Built-in +12/+15 V bias (S251C) • Option 21: 2-port scalar transmission measurements (S332D) • Option 25: Interference Analyzer (S332D) • Option 27: Channel Scanner (S332D) • Option 28: CW Signal (S332D) • Option 29: Power Meter from 3 MHz to 3 GHz (S331D and S332D) • Option 31: Built-in GPS receiver provides latitude, longitude, altitude information with trace data (S331D, S332D, S810D and S820D) • Option 50: T1/E1 Analyzer (S331D)
Applications Cellular, ISM, PCS/PCN, paging service, safety service, avionics, two-way radio, military, and microwave point-to-point radio. Site Master allows implementation of preventative maintenance procedures. Unlike TDRs and spectrum analyzers/tracking generators, Site Master can spot RF degradation before failures occur. Problems can be fixed before expensive cables or waveguides are ruined. Site Master is designed for field requirements. Its rugged construction survives rough field treatment. Battery power, light weight, small size, wide temperature range, and simple user interface are exactly what field technicians want today. Technicians can test antennas from ground level because Site Master’s distance-to-fault measurement compensates for cable insertion loss. Furthermore, spectrum analysis, available in certain Site Master models, allows technicians and field engineers to quickly identify and solve common RF system problems, such as coverage, interference, and other path related signal problems. Site Master offers a new and better method to install and maintain transmission lines and antennas.

Anritsu S330A Site Master, Cable and Antenna Analyzer, 700 MHz to 3300 MHz
|
Anritsu S330A Site Master, Cable and Antenna Analyzer, 700 MHz to 3300 MHz
The Site Master S330A is a hand held SWR/RL(standing wave ratio/return loss) and Distance-To-Fault measurement instrument that includes a built-in synthesized signal source and an optional power monitor. It uses a keypad to enter data and a liquid crystal display (LCD) to provide a graphical indication of SWR or RL over the selected frequency range. The Site Master S330A allows measurement data to be converted to Fault Location via the companion Software Tools program. The Site Master is capable of up to two hours of continuous operation from a fully charged internal battery. It can also be operated from a 12.5 dc source (which will also simultaneously charge the battery). Built-in energy conservation features can be used to extend battery life over an eight-hour work day.
The Site Master is designed for measuring SWR, return loss, or cable insertion loss and locating faulty RF components in antenna systems. Power monitoring capability is available as an option. The displayed trace can be scaled and/or enhanced with settable frequency markers and/or a limit line. A menu option provides for an audible “beep” when the limit value is exceeded. To permit use in low-light environments, the LCD can be back lit using a front panel key.

Anritsu S810C Site Master Microwave Transmission Line and Antenna Analyzer, 3.3 GHz to 10 GHz
|
Anritsu’s hand held, battery operated S810C Microwave Site Master is the most accurate and convenient tool available for field installation, verification, troubleshooting and repair of microwave communication systems. Difficult test specifications become easy to verify. The S810C improves quality and reduces maintenance expenses by providing vector corrected measurements via calibration and a convenient user interface. Microwave Site Master S810C targets microwave site installers, point-to-point operators, point-to-multipoint operators, radio manufacturers, PCS/Cellular operators, utility companies and private/public networks that support microwave links. These microwave Site Master models test both waveguide and coaxial cables more conveniently than laboratory sized scalar analyzers or microwave test sets.
Key Features • Accurately tests coaxial cable/waveguide transmission line and antennas • Tune mode for waveguide component alignment/testing • Superior immunity to live site RF interference • Clearly defined user interface for coaxial cable and waveguide media • Pop up menus for cable list, waveguide list and compatible flange list • Quickly select cable/waveguide type and test parameters without setup error • Large, high resolution display allows for easy viewing and trace interpretation under a variety of conditions
Easy-to-Use Site Master’s S810C menu driven interface requires little training and simplifies the field engineers’ and technicians’ task of deployment, site-to-site maintenance and troubleshooting by identifying, recording and solving problems without sacrificing measurement accuracy. • Store ten test setups for fast, repeatable testing. • Store up to 200 measurement traces in nonvolatile memory. • Multilingual user interface features on screen menus and messages in 7 different languages – English, German, French, Spanish, Portuguese, Chinese, and Japanese.
Vector Error Correction Vector error correction within the S800 “C” Series improves the quality and convenience of measurements compared to traditional scalar techniques. Accuracy and repeatability are enhanced as errors such as test port match and source match are accounted for.
Waveguide Calibration The test port connection to the waveguide under test is a small coaxial-to-waveguide adapter rather than a bulky coupler. The calibration components include two offset shorts, 1/8 and 3/8 wave-length, and a precision waveguide load. The two offset shorts eliminate reference error suffered by scalar systems where only a single waveguide short is used to determine the 0.0 dB reflection reference level. Site Master’s flange design mates to square, rectangular or circular flanges. For a given waveguide size, only one calibration set is required. Site Master’s waveguide calibration components are built with precision alignment pins that mate the companion coaxial-to-waveguide adapters. As a result, proper alignment to the waveguide is fast and convenient.
Waveguide Dispersion Vector error correction also improves the quality of Distance-To-Fault data. Not only is the reflection magnitude more accurate, but the waveguide dispersion correction for fault location (different frequencies propagate at different speeds) is more accurate and repeatable. The postvector corrected data accounts for the non-dispersive length of coaxial cable preceding the input of the waveguide under test. Unlike scalar-based systems, the Microwave Site Master S800 “C” Series does not suffer reflection magnitude errors and length inaccuracies in proportion to the relative lengths of the coaxial input cable and waveguide under test.
Tune Mode Tune Mode is a fast sweep mode used to quickly tune the waveguide by adjusting the flange connectors quickly at both ends of the waveguide. There are three levels of resolution available for tune mode; 65, 43, and 33 data points. The higher the number of data points, the greater the measurement resolution.
